Package com.github.junrar.unpack.ppm
Class ModelPPM
java.lang.Object
com.github.junrar.unpack.ppm.ModelPPM
DOCUMENT ME
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ionintbooleandecodeInit(Unpack unpackRead, int escChar) int[][]int[]getCoder()intint[]byte[]getHeap()intintintint[]int[]intintintintSEE2Context[][]voidincEscCount(int dEscCount) voidincRunLength(int dRunLength) voidsetEscCount(int escCount) voidsetHiBitsFlag(int hiBitsFlag) voidsetInitEsc(int initEsc) voidsetNumMasked(int numMasked) voidsetPrevSuccess(int prevSuccess) voidsetRunLength(int runLength) toString()
-
Field Details
-
MAX_O
public static final int MAX_O- See Also:
-
INT_BITS
public static final int INT_BITS- See Also:
-
PERIOD_BITS
public static final int PERIOD_BITS- See Also:
-
TOT_BITS
public static final int TOT_BITS- See Also:
-
INTERVAL
public static final int INTERVAL- See Also:
-
BIN_SCALE
public static final int BIN_SCALE- See Also:
-
MAX_FREQ
public static final int MAX_FREQ- See Also:
-
-
Constructor Details
-
ModelPPM
public ModelPPM()
-
-
Method Details
-
getSubAlloc
-
decodeInit
- Throws:
IOExceptionRarException
-
decodeChar
- Throws:
IOExceptionRarException
-
getSEE2Cont
-
getDummySEE2Cont
-
getInitRL
public int getInitRL() -
setEscCount
public void setEscCount(int escCount) -
getEscCount
public int getEscCount() -
incEscCount
public void incEscCount(int dEscCount) -
getCharMask
public int[] getCharMask() -
getNumMasked
public int getNumMasked() -
setNumMasked
public void setNumMasked(int numMasked) -
setPrevSuccess
public void setPrevSuccess(int prevSuccess) -
getInitEsc
public int getInitEsc() -
setInitEsc
public void setInitEsc(int initEsc) -
setRunLength
public void setRunLength(int runLength) -
getRunLength
public int getRunLength() -
incRunLength
public void incRunLength(int dRunLength) -
getPrevSuccess
public int getPrevSuccess() -
getHiBitsFlag
public int getHiBitsFlag() -
setHiBitsFlag
public void setHiBitsFlag(int hiBitsFlag) -
getBinSumm
public int[][] getBinSumm() -
getCoder
-
getHB2Flag
public int[] getHB2Flag() -
getNS2BSIndx
public int[] getNS2BSIndx() -
getNS2Indx
public int[] getNS2Indx() -
getFoundState
-
getHeap
public byte[] getHeap() -
getOrderFall
public int getOrderFall() -
toString
-